The treatment entails using a whitening gel to your teeth and after that utilizing a laser to turn on the gel, speeding up the lightening process. An additional common question is whether the laser is as effective as other bleaching techniques. Laser lightening works in a similar way to typical methods that use a whitening gel and a light. The gel is applied, and the light triggers it to break down the surface area stains. Yes, both teeth lightening and whitening can create level of sensitivity. However, the higher peroxide concentration made use of in laser therapy is most likely to cause discomfort or pain throughout a session. While laser teeth bleaching and whitening are safe without lasting damages to enamel or gums, some people might experience boosted sensitivity throughout their therapy. With laser treatments, the peroxide concentration used by dental experts can be more than that located in bleach trays, yet less applications and shorter sessions balance this out. If you have gum condition (gingivitis), whitening therapies such as this aren't a fantastic alternative. The treatment can aggravate healthy and balanced periodontals, so placing it in harmful gum tissues is likely to cause even more discomfort.
